TDG Environmental is a trusted leader in sustainable waste and stormwater management across Australia and New Zealand. With over 30 years of experience and more than 2 million tonnes of waste managed annually, TDG plays a critical role in supporting the circular economy through four advanced recycling facilities. As demand increased, building the right resourcing model to support growth without overloading internal teams, became a strategic focus.

Phase 2: Start lean, scale with certainty

The partnership began with a focused placement: a skilled data analyst who quickly filled a critical gap. Early success gave TDG Group the confidence to expand, adding an accounts payable officer and, more recently, exploring further support for accounts receivable.

Each stage was thoughtfully paced to demonstrate value, build trust and ensure readiness before growing the team further.
